While black is the traditional funeral color in many cultures, green is sometimes incorporated as an accent color or used in floral arrangements to convey specific sentiments. Mar 7, 2026 · What Does Wearing Green to a Funeral Mean? Decoding Funeral Attire The significance of wearing green to a funeral varies, but in most modern Western cultures, it is considered a symbol of hope, renewal, and respect for the deceased’s life, offering a contrast to the traditional somber colors and suggesting a celebration of life rather than focusing solely on grief.
